His 1964 paper on "Presentations of groupoids with applications to groups" introduced me to the idea that groupoids could be used for algebraic computations. A key construction in this paper is that of a new groupoid U_f(G) over Y from a groupoid G and a function f: Ob(G) --> Y. This construction easily gives free groups and free products of groups, and has important higher dimensional generalisations. This paper led me to a Seifert-van Kampen theorem for the fundamental grouoid on a set of base points, allowing applications to unions of spaces for which they or their intersections are not connected, such as the circle. This work led in 1974 to a long term collaboration on higher groupoids and their applications. He had a wonderful way of organising complex algebraic material, and much of this expository skill is shown in the book R. Brown, P.J. Higgins, R. Sivera, "Nonabelian algebraic topology: filtered spaces, crossed complexes, cubical homotopy groupoids", EMS Tracts in Mathematics Vol. 15, 703 pages. (August 2011). where major central parts are lifted from our joint papers. When he got into a new subject, he saw ways of clarifying the matter and exposition. This is shown in his work with Kirill Mackenzie on Lie groupoids and algebroids. His early work on groups with operators, and on the algebraic theory of algebras with partial operations, are still refereed to. At one time he had to choose between two professions, and decided he could have more fun as a professional mathematician and an amateur violinist. His craftmanship is shown that in his retirement he took up again making for his grandchildren violins, violas and cellos, each one taking about a year. I miss a good friend.
